Output 8359b6d51ff943bf6b4b60e94d95c47cfc157d28908b2608687c145c5ec506af:13

value
3718774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 499f21836b8c3ce02c143edca490dc930d467d4e OP_EQUAL
address
38QHtA4DY7SaDe6nGcFdZGWZF4wQMRX1Tv
transaction
8359b6d51ff943bf6b4b60e94d95c47cfc157d28908b2608687c145c5ec506af
spent
true